Transaction 68c8b9143fe6bf38037ddf74f91fde4a563b165b4d87394b741922bebc83238b
1 Input
2 Outputs
- 68c8b9143fe6bf38037ddf74f91fde4a563b165b4d87394b741922bebc83238b:0
- 68c8b9143fe6bf38037ddf74f91fde4a563b165b4d87394b741922bebc83238b:1
value 1277905
address 19TWhKRSGdU8tCjiwEH5kpZR5YmayCf6oo
value 57764501
address 18QrQMvk9RaPum9ktoyY8Kp3g5iB1T7ebv